Proyecto web construido con Astro y TailwindCSS para el semillero de desarrollo web.
Este proyecto es una aplicación web moderna que utiliza Astro como framework principal, junto con TailwindCSS para los estilos. Incluye características como carruseles de imágenes (usando Embla Carousel) y resaltado de código (usando Highlight.js).
semillero_pixel/
├── src/
│ ├── assets/ # Recursos estáticos (imágenes, etc)
│ ├── components/ # Componentes reutilizables
│ ├── layouts/ # Plantillas de página
│ ├── lib/ # Utilidades y funciones auxiliares
│ ├── pages/ # Páginas de la aplicación
│ ├── sections/ # Secciones de página
│ ├── share_components/ # Componentes compartidos
│ └── styles/ # Estilos globales
├── public/ # Archivos públicos
└── astro.config.mjs # Configuración de Astro
- Astro - Framework web
- TailwindCSS - Framework de CSS
- Embla Carousel - Para carruseles
- Highlight.js - Resaltado de código
-
Clona el repositorio:
git clone https://github.com/igrisdev/semillero_pixel.git cd semillero_pixel -
Instala las dependencias:
npm install # o bun install -
Crea un archivo
.env.localcon las variables de entorno necesarias -
Inicia el servidor de desarrollo:
npm run dev # o bun dev -
Abre http://localhost:4321 en tu navegador
dev- Inicia el servidor de desarrollobuild- Construye el proyecto para producciónpreview- Previsualiza la build de producción localmente
El proyecto utiliza varias herramientas de desarrollo:
- Prettier - Para formateo de código
- TailwindCSS Typography - Para estilos de contenido
Desplegada en Vercel ver URL en descripción